Comparison highlights

  • Moat score gap: CSX Corporation leads (74 / 100 vs 61 / 100 for The Italian Sea Group S.p.A.).
  • Segment focus: CSX Corporation has 5 segments (61.2% in Merchandise (Rail)); The Italian Sea Group S.p.A. has 2 segments (89.7% in Shipbuilding).
  • Moat breadth: CSX Corporation has 6 moat types across 2 domains; The Italian Sea Group S.p.A. has 5 across 3.
